The acracy
is the political system of Hôdons.
The idea is developed in the novels of the Pioneers of Hôdo. The pioneers of Hôdo were each one representatives of various political, military, economic, religious powers. The first human colony was to be a as the often fanaticized ideal that each one defended, and who was rejected, at least, by half of the other colonists. But above all, it was necessary to survive. Initially, the colonists put up with the very hierarchical structure of the astronauts, more adapted to survival in medium, if not hostile, at least inhospitable. The chief of the trek proposed a charter, the "ten commandments" which were to ensure the cohabitations of the pioneers. That law was the only one, but an absolute must. It was to make it possible each Hôdon to live according to its convictions without however harm the others.
What characterizes the acracy, is the absence of any kind of power allotted to hierarchy of any type.
Hôdo is a hyper federation bringing together small units, called clans, composed of about eight people. These clans join between them for various reasons, mainly by affinity or need. Than, there are at least two pyramids joining together Hôdons, one social, the functional.
The hierarchy has only two roles: to coordinate the efforts of each one to build Hôdo, and to take care of "the good vicinity" while respecting the diversity of Hôdons.
